What Does a a Medicare Insurance Agent in Milford Cost?
Medicare insurance agents in Ohio are typically paid by insurance carriers, not by you directly. You may pay a premium for a Medigap plan ranging from $100 to $300 per month depending on your age and health. Medicare Advantage plans often have $0 monthly premiums but include copays and deductibles. This is general information, not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the best time to enroll in Medicare in Milford Ohio?
Your Initial Enrollment Period starts three months before you turn 65 and ends three months after your birthday month. Ohio also has a General Enrollment Period from January 1 to March 31 each year. Missing these windows may result in late enrollment penalties.
Can a Medicare agent help me switch plans in Ohio?
Yes. You can switch plans during the Annual Enrollment Period from October 15 to December 7. Ohio also allows a Medicare Advantage Open Enrollment Period from January 1 to March 31. An agent can explain which plans are available in Clermont County.
